Sweet potato casserole, a beloved Thanksgiving staple, poses a culinary question that has puzzled generations: does it require refrigeration? To answer this enigmatic query, let’s delve into the science behind food preservation and explore the unique characteristics of this savory dish.

The Science of Food Spoilage

Food spoilage is primarily driven by the growth of microorganisms, such as bacteria and mold. These microbes thrive in warm, moist environments and can rapidly multiply, leading to the deterioration of food. Refrigeration slows down this process by reducing microbial growth, extending the shelf life of perishable items.

Sweet Potato Casserole: A Delicate Delight

Sweet potato casserole is a rich, creamy dish typically prepared with mashed sweet potatoes, spices, and a sweet topping. The high moisture content and presence of sugars make it an ideal breeding ground for bacteria if left unrefrigerated.

Refrigeration Recommendations

To ensure the safety and quality of your sweet potato casserole, refrigeration is strongly recommended. Here are the guidelines to follow:

After Baking

  • Once baked, allow the casserole to cool to room temperature for 2 hours.
  • Transfer the casserole to an airtight container and refrigerate promptly.

Storage Duration

  • Refrigerated sweet potato casserole can be stored for up to 3-4 days.

Reheating

  • Before serving, reheat the casserole in the oven or microwave until warmed through.

Exceptions to the Rule

While refrigeration is generally advised, there are exceptions to the rule:

Freshly Prepared Casserole

  • If the casserole is freshly prepared and consumed within 24 hours, refrigeration may not be necessary. However, it’s still advisable to store it in a cool place to minimize spoilage.

Canned Sweet Potatoes

  • Commercially canned sweet potatoes are typically shelf-stable and do not require refrigeration before opening. Once opened, follow the manufacturer’s instructions for storage.

Signs of Spoilage

If you suspect your sweet potato casserole has spoiled, look for these telltale signs:

  • Mold growth on the surface
  • Unpleasant odor or sour taste
  • Discoloration or darkening
  • Watery or slimy texture

Health Implications of Spoiled Casserole

Consuming spoiled sweet potato casserole can lead to foodborne illness, characterized by sym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al pain. In severe cases, it can cause serious health complications.

What You Need to Learn

Q: Can I freeze sweet potato casserole?
A: Yes, you can freeze sweet potato casserole for up to 2 months. Allow it to cool completely before freezing.

Q: How can I reheat sweet potato casserole without drying it out?
A: Add a splash of milk or water to the casserole before reheating. Cover it with foil to retain moisture.

Q: Can I make sweet potato casserole ahead of time?
A: Yes, you can prepare the casserole up to 24 hours in advance. Store it in the refrigerator and bake it before serving.

Q: Is it okay to leave sweet potato casserole out overnight?
A: No, it is not safe to leave sweet potato casserole out overnight. Refrigerate it within 2 hours of baking.

Q: Can I use canned sweet potatoes instead of fresh?
A: Yes, you can substitute canned sweet potatoes for fresh ones. Be sure to drain the excess liquid before using.
